About the role
This position is located in the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A), Farm Production and Conservation (FPAC)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S), Rhode Island State Office and reports to the State Conservationist. Provides staff leadership in engineering programs of NRCS in Rhode Island, including formulation of standards, specifications, engineering planning, design and construction; analyzes engineering work and training to recommend training and placement of engineering personnel.
